    What's the best order to build a rig?

    Someone passed onto me and I will pass onto you for the first purchase would be a front bumper with a winch. Why? When you out wheeling, camping in remote places or helping a buddy get out of a sticky situation you just have that security. Sent from my SM-G920V using OB Talk mobile app
